CTOnews.com, March 6-Sony Semiconductor Solutions (SSS) today announced the upcoming release of the IMX611 Image Sensor, a dToF SPAD depth of field sensor for smartphones that provides the industry's highest photon detection efficiency.
Sony says the IMX611 has a photon detection efficiency of 28%, thanks to its proprietary single-photon avalanche diode (single-photon avalanche diode,SPAD) pixel structure. This structure reduces the power consumption of the whole system and realizes the measurement of high-precision object distance.
CTOnews.com Note: SPAD is a pixel structure that uses avalanche multiplication to amplify electrons from a single incident photon, causing an avalanche-like cascade.
According to the structure of the ▲ SPAD ToF depth of field sensor, the Sony IMX611, with a size of 8.1 inch and an effective pixel of 23000, will ship samples this month (March 2023) at a tax price of 1000 yen (currently about 51 yuan).
Sony said that in general, the SPAD can be used as a detector in the dToF sensor, which obtains distance information by detecting the flight time of the light emitted from the light source when it is reflected by the object.
IMX611 uses a proprietary SPAD pixel structure, so that the sensor has the highest photon detection efficiency in the industry, even very weak photons emitted from the light source and reflected from the object can be detected, thus achieving high-precision distance measurement. This also means that the sensor can provide high ranging performance even at a lower light source laser output, which helps to reduce the power consumption of the entire smartphone system.
The ▲ test demonstration Sony also said that the sensor can accurately measure the distance of an object, thus improving autofocus performance in low-light environments with poor visibility, applying scatter effect to the main background, and seamlessly switching between wide-angle and telephoto cameras. All of these features will improve the user experience of smartphone cameras. The sensor also supports 3D space recognition, AR occlusion, motion capture / gesture recognition and other functions. With the popularity of the virtual world in the future, the sensor will contribute to the functional evolution of VR head-mounted displays and AR glasses, and these requirements are expected to increase.
